Looking to cast a line in Orange Beach? Cagle’s Offshore Charters is here to make it happen! Your guide for the day is Captain Bobby, bringing aboard years of local experience.
These waters are known for Amberjack, Black Grouper, Sailfish, King Mackerel, Mahi Mahi, Rainbow Runner, Red Snapper, Vermilion Snapper, Scamp Grouper, Great Barracuda, Blue Marlin, White Marlin, and more – with any luck, it won’t take long to hook into some. On these trips, it’s common to troll and bottom fish using light or heavy tackle.
The fish caught are yours to take home, provided they’re legal to keep. Plus, you can have your catch cleaned. Talk about bang for your buck!
Planning a family adventure? Kids are absolutely welcome! Children must wear life vests, so find out if the appropriate size is available on board. Also, remember to bring snacks so that nobody gets cranky on an empty stomach!
Your boat for the day is the Hakuna Matata, a 30’ Rampage express cruiser that can carry up to 6 passengers. It has outriggers, downriggers, and everything else you need for a productive day on the water. There’s a toilet on board for your convenience. What’s more, this vessel is wheelchair accessible. Your captain will provide rods and reels, along with lures. Live bait is included, but you should ask the captain whether you’ll be catching it yourself.
There’s no need to buy a fishing license, just show up ready for some fishing! Have in mind that some fish may have harvest limits or closed seasons. If you don’t know what to expect, ask the captain.
It’s never a bad idea to bring sunscreen (non-spray), a hat, bottled water, and sunglasses. If you’d like to bring other drinks, just ask.
